Abstract :
A new nanorobotics platform under development and which could be used for high-throughput biomedical applications at the nanometer-scale is briefly described. Each platform is based on a fleet of approximately 100 miniature autonomous instrumented robots, each capable of nanometer-scale operations. A central computer coordinates the operations of each miniature robot based on instructions received previously.
